How do we select blog content?


Who can contribute?

  • Any person or organization that is a member of the Greater Vancouver Board of Trade.
  • Any person or organization that provides sponsored content.
  • Any person or organization solicited by the GVBOT that writes content as a guest collaborator.
  • All submitted content must meet requirements laid out in this editorial policy.
  • The decision to publish any contributed content is taken at the sole discretion of the GVBOT.
  • All contributions are made on a voluntary or sponsored basis and are not subject to any remuneration.

What kind of content is published?

  • The GVBOT blog is where readers expect to find expert content that offers advice, insight, and information on subjects that impact their businesses.
  • Posts on the blog are helpful, not-self promotional. There is no jargon or corporate speak.


We judge contributions based on the following criteria:

Expertise – We publish content from contributors who are well-versed in the subject-matter they are writing about.

Accuracy – In addition to their own subject matter knowledge, contributors must be able to support their claims and ideas through research and data.

Insight – Our readers come to the blog for insight, as such all content published must offer insight and expertise that will bring value to their busy lives.

Independence – The GVBOT blog is a non-partisan publication. No promotional or partisan content will be included.

Relevance – Only content that is relevant to our readers, the Greater Vancouver business community, will be published.

What format should contributions be made in?

  • Content may be submitted in written format, produced to the Canadian Press style.
  • You must include an image with your submitted content. This must take the form of a copyright-free photograph.
  • Blog posts must be between a minimum of 500 words and a maximum of 900 words in length.

What are the conditions for selection?

  • We will not publish any content that is offensive, sexist, or discriminatory in nature.
  • Sources must be identified. Contributors must make sure to hold the copyright for the material being submitted, as only original content will be accepted.
  • By submitting content for publication contributors automatically agree to the conditions laid out in this editorial policy.
  • The GVBOT reserves the right to edit the title or certain parts of a text before publication; contributors will be made aware of the changes before publication.
